Section C, Crystal structure communications 2001 JulIn the the title compound, 1,7-dimethyl-8-oxo-4balpha,7alpha-gibba-1,3,4a(10a)-triene-10beta-carboxylic acid monohydrate, C18H20O3*H2O, the water of hydration accepts a hydrogen bond from the carboxyl and donates hydrogen bonds to the carboxyl carbonyl and the ketone in two different screw-related neighbors, which are mutually translational, yielding a complex three-dimensional hydrogen-bonding array.
H W Thompson, R A Lalancette. gibberic acid: hydrogen-bonding pattern of the monohydrate of a non-racemic tetracyclic delta-keto acid derivative of gibberellin A3. Acta crystallographica. Section C, Crystal structure communications. 2001 Jul;57(Pt 7):841-3
